This video shows the capabilities of the Naval Expeditionary Medical Training Institute’s (NEMTI) Expeditionary Resuscitative Surgical System (ERSS) Training & Simulation course and of Navy Medicine’s ERSS Teams. Navy Medicine’s ERSS Teams are mobile medical units capable of saving lives and limbs in distributed maritime environments.

Navy Expeditionary Medical Training Institute personnel provided high fidelity simulation support at sea aboard USS Makin Island (LHD-8) during exercise Steel Knight 22 (SK22), Dec. 6. SK22 is a 1st Marine Division led annual training exercise which enables the Navy-Marine Corps team to operate in a realistic combined-arms environment to enhance naval warfighting tactics, techniques and procedures. Navy USS Makin Island (LHD-8) and Fleet Surgical Team NINE, Army 8th Forward Resuscitative Surgical Detachment, and US Marine Corps Combat Logistics Battalion-13 came together as a single Joint Health Services Support team to exercise casualty receiving at sea aboard USS MAKIN ISLAND during exercise Steel Knight 22 (SK22), Dec. 6. SK22 is a 1st Marine Division led annual training exercise which enables the Navy-Marine Corps team to operate in a realistic combined-arms environment to enhance naval warfighting tactics, techniques and procedures. High fidelity trauma simulation support was provided by NEMTI. (Photo Courtesy of NEMTI)
